How to Tell If You Need a Water Line Repair or Replacement
Houses get water from a main resource which might be public or personal. This water line is usually set up underground with top quality water pipes that need to last for a very long time. However, as time advances the materials used in the water lines become more susceptible to environmental or internal problems that trigger them to weaken. Hence, we can come across plumbing issues like leaks, staining, bad water stress, foul odors, etc. Problems with your water line need to not be taken with levity as they can progress to a lot more serious damage. Typical water line issues include;
  • Leaking valves

  • Mineral deposits

  • Broken or broken pipelines

  • Corroded pipes

  • The Problem of Repair Service or Replace


    Homeowners are typically confronted with these two selections anytime there's a plumbing issue. It is required for you to meticulously evaluate the situation at hand and with respect to previous and also future signs make an informed option. Reviewing this with your plumber is highly encouraged. If the water line is old (regarding half a century old) you should be thinking about replacing it. This is due to the fact that such plumbing problems are related to maturing advertisement are likely to return. If you have been repairing below ground plumbing issues for some time, a full replacement will additionally conserve you a further migraine in the future. Nevertheless, if the materials are not old as well as can quickly be fixed for less than it will certainly require to change, go with the repair work choice.

    Typical Root Causes Of Water Line Concerns


    Your water line being hidden below ground subjects it to many interior and external conditions. Any kind of damages endured can be because of one or more of the adhering to;
  • Rust

  • Parasite damage

  • Penetrations by tree origins

  • Soil disturbances

  • Interior mineral accumulation

  • Damage

  • Freezing and thawing and also lots of others.

  • Exactly how To Know That Your Water Line is Damaged


    Being underground, problems with your water line can go unnoticed for several years until substantial damages has been done. However, there are some reminders that you can look out for. Being able to recognize these signs means that you can ask for specialist assistance on schedule. Several of these include;
  • Shaking noises in pipelines when no water is running

  • Pools on your yard when it has actually not drizzled

  • Water leakage on the streets

  • New cracks to your home's foundation

  • Low tide pressure

  • Discolored or smelly water

  • Mold, mold, and also moisture at the lower levels of your residence

  • These reminders suggest a hidden problem that should be expertly attended to as soon as possible.

    Trenchless Water Line Fixing


    In contrast to old techniques which call for total excavation of the waterline, the trenchless method supplies the option of fixing problems within a much shorter time. It includes the installation of pipes of smaller sized diameter within the old ones. This size difference as little or no impact on efficiency. This method is useful since it is non-invasive as well as cost-effective. This approach makes it possible for repair to be completed within a day or more with minimum disturbance to your lawn.

    When Should I Replace My Water Line to My Michigan House?


    Wondering when you should replace your home’s water line? Unfortunately, there’s no one-size-fits-all answer. Water mains have a different lifespan depending on various factors, like the material of the line and the minerals in the area’s water.



    The best way to determine whether or not your water line needs replacement is to have a professional assess your main water line and provide you with an expert opinion.


    However, we can tell you that you should consider replacing your main water line if:


  • It contains lead or galvanized steel


  • It’s corroded or damaged in multiple places


  • It’s 40+ years old


  • Repairing it will cost 50% (or more) than replacing it
